Manchester United's Nigeria-Eligible Striker Named To Latest Netherlands U17 Roster
Published: November 04, 2019
Manchester United striker of Nigerian descent, Dillon Hoogewerf has been included in the latest Netherlands U17 squad, allnigeriasoccer.com reports.
For the third international break of the 2019-2020 season, KNVB coach Mischa Visser has called up 21 players for the trip to United States, where they will play friendly matches against the hosts and Turkey.
The back-to-back European U17 champions face the United States on November 14, then Turkey on November 16 and finally the United States Under 18 two days later.
Should he switch his allegiance to Nigeria in future, Hoogewerf has to apply to FIFA for a change of association after making his competitive debut for the Dutch U17 squad in a European Championship qualifier against Kosovo last month.
In-form Sparta Rotterdam starlet Emanuel Emegha, who was initially included in a 33-man provisional squad, did not make the final list announced on Monday by the Dutch Federation.
The center forward has registered his name on the scoresheet nine times in his last five games in the Preliminary round U17 Eredivisie.
Hoogewerf and Emegha previously represented Netherlands U15 squad.
